## Abstract

The nose is a frequently affected site for skin cancers, thus it should always be considered when addressing pathologies of the external apex nasi. This case report presents a 28-year-old woman with an atypical nasal tip mass, characterized as a keratinous cyst demonstrating a multinucleated giant cell reaction and calcification. The mass, which had gradually enlarged over 3 years, was successfully removed using an open rhinoplasty technique. Preoperative imaging studies, including ultrasound, noncontrast CT, and MRI, revealed specific characteristics of the mass, aiding in diagnosis and surgical planning. The study underscores the need for increased awareness about nasal tip deformities caused by keratinous cysts, emphasizing the need for comprehensive diagnostic and therapeutic strategies to improve patient outcomes.
